Understanding Mensa's Membership Requirements
The Mensa organization has a clear set of requirements for membership, one of which is to have an official IQ score. Whether you're familiar with Mensa or new to the concept, it's important to understand that there are only two accepted methods for obtaining the necessary IQ score: a professional IQ test or a Mensa-administered intelligence test.
Historical Cases of Membership Without an Official IQ Test
In the past, there have been instances where individuals were invited to join Mensa based on standardized test scores such as the Graduate Record Examination (GRE). For example, the author of this article received an unsolicited membership invitation based on their GRE scores decades ago. However, it's crucial to note that this was 33 years ago, and the rules and procedures may have changed over time.
Alternative Paths to Mensa Membership
Despite the strict requirements, it is indeed possible to join Mensa without taking an official IQ test administered by Mensa. Here's a step-by-step guide on how to achieve this:
Obtain Proof of Prior Testing: Search for and secure documents that provide evidence of a previous intelligence test score. Check Score Requirements: Determine the specific score requirements for Mensa membership. The minimum score typically required is 132 (or 135, depending on the version of the test). Submit the Application and Documentation: Visit the Mensa website and complete the application process, providing all required documentation. Wait for Verification: Mensa will review your application and documentation to verify your IQ score. This process may take some time.
